Average CDL Tuition in Wisconsin
$3,500 - $7,500
Based on 636 training programs in Wisconsin. Prices vary by program length and endorsements.
- Company-sponsored: Often FREE
- WIOA Grants: Up to $10,000
- GI Bill®: Full coverage for veterans
CDL Requirements for Wisconsin
- Must be 18+ (21+ for interstate)
- Valid Wisconsin driver's license
- DOT medical card (physical exam)
- ELDT training from approved provider
- Pass Wisconsin DMV written & skills test
Types of CDL Training Available in Wisconsin
Class A CDL
Tractor-trailers, 18-wheelers, tankers
Class B CDL
Straight trucks, buses, dump trucks
Endorsements
Hazmat, Tanker, Doubles, Passenger
